18 Rounds Fired At Newark Hotel Party, Claymont Man Shot In The Back

&nbNewark- The Delaware State Police are investigating a shooting incident that occurred early this morning and left one man wounded, according to Public Information Officer, Corporal/1 Jason Hatchell.

Hatchell said the incident occurred on August 22, 2020, at approximately 12:25 a.m., when Troopers were dispatched to the Sonesta Suites, located at 240 Chapman Road in Newark, in reference to a shooting. Upon arrival, it was discovered that a 21-year-old Claymont man had been shot and was being taken to the hospital by other subjects on scene.

Troopers located the vehicle in transport to the hospital and performed lifesaving first-aid until Emergency Medical Services arrived. The victim was then transported by ambulance to a local hospital for a gunshot wound to his back and left arm.

Further investigation revealed that the victim was at the hotel for a party in one of the rooms. While in the parking lot there were multiple gunshots, and the victim was struck twice. A total of 18 rounds were fired at the scene from four separate caliber firearms.

Troopers recovered a Smith and Wesson .38 special revolver at the scene.

There is no suspect information at this time and no other reported injuries.
